Release Guard for AI Dev Tools

Build a release-safety SaaS and CLI companion that detects known-bad versions of AI developer tools before or immediately after upgrades. It would run smoke checks, flag risky release combinations, and offer one-click rollback or version pinning guidance.

Por que isso importa

You update a coding agent expecting improvements, then the dashboard chat stops working and your normal workflow disappears. The CLI may still run, but the visual path you depend on is broken, and every attempt to update or reload produces the same loop. Instead of shipping code, you are comparing issue threads, guessing whether the bug is network-related, and testing environment flags by hand. The built-in updater does not protect you from a bad release, and the official fix may not be merged yet. What you really want is a safety layer that recognizes risky versions, validates your setup after upgrade, and gives you a clean rollback path before the broken state costs hours.

Escopo do MVP · 1–2 semanas

Semana 1
  • Build a CLI that detects installed tool version and environment mode
  • Create a small hosted registry of known-bad versions and fixed versions
  • Implement a basic smoke test for dashboard chat page load and WebSocket attach
  • Add terminal output for rollback, pinning, or skip-upgrade recommendations
  • Set up a landing page with waitlist and self-serve onboarding
Semana 2
  • Add GitHub Action support to block upgrades to flagged versions
  • Implement telemetry for smoke-test pass or fail by version and mode
  • Create one-click config export for bug reports and team sharing
  • Add Slack or email alerts for detected regressions in CI
  • Expand the registry to 2-3 adjacent AI dev tools to validate broader demand

Por que isso pode falhar

Auto-refutação — o sinal de confiança mais importante

  1. 1The pain may be episodic rather than frequent enough for many solo developers to justify a subscription.
  2. 2Upstream maintainers could quickly add their own release guardrails and shrink the product's differentiation.
  3. 3Environment-specific rollback and validation may be harder to standardize than expected across local installs.
